Plaintiffs Irene Young and Jesse Chang seek to compel initial responses from Defendant Pacific Plaza Elite-Alhambra Homeowners Association as to their form interrogatories, set two, and special interrogatories, set one.
Defendant indicates that it has provided responses to the interrogatories at issue.
Therefore, the Motions to Compel are denied as moot.
Plaintiffs request $2,330 in sanctions for each Motion. The Court awards reduced sanctions in the total amount of $1,000.
